Title :
Peer to peer technologies in future LTE self-organizing networks

Abstract :
In LTE networks, self-organizing and self-management become more and more important. So 3GPP defined SON (Self Organizing Networks) in the standards. On the other hand, P2P (Peer to Peer) technologies improved in self-organizing and self management areas for a long period. Many classic and useful algorithms generated for various applications. What kind of P2P technologies can be used for LTE SON, and how to use them? We will give some basic ideas about the questions in the paper, which is useful for further study. Firstly, we list the requirements of LTE SON and P2P related technologies and features; and then study the possible uses of P2P technologies for LTE SON on architecture, search algorithm, topology aware and load balancing aspects; finally, we give a prospective outlook on future LTE networks.
